WCC Vision Statement

 

Prayerfully seeking God's guidance, and following His direction, Westside Christian Church will be an externally focused church; a Christ-centered congregation with excellence in programming, and dynamic ministries for all ages, providing an environment which encourages personal growth in Christ.

 

WCC Core Values

 

Our core values serve as a directional compass to keep us on course.

 

We are committed to Growth

Numerical growth is important because God loves each individual person.

(2 Peter 3:9)

God expects his people to grow into spiritual maturity.

(Ephesians 4:13-15)

 

We are committed to the Word of God

The Bible is God’s inspired Word and it is absolute truth for all times, cultures, and nations.

(2 Timothy 3:16-17)

 

We are committed to operating as a community of servants

God expects Christians to follow the example of Jesus Christ who became a servant/leader to His people. We accomplish this by using our gifts, talents, and abilities to further the Kingdom of God (the Church).

(Ephesians 4:12, Romans 12: 6)

 

We are committed to being a Christ-centered fellowship

Our individual, lives, families, and church should be structured in such a way to exalt the name of Jesus Christ.

(Ephesians 1:22, Mark 12:10)

 

We are committed to people

God is a loving Father who cares deeply for each person.

(John 3:16)

 

We are committed to excellence

In everything we do, we give God only our best.

(Romans 3:32, Colossians 3:23)

 

We are committed to Biblical community

Our fellowship is committed to gathering together for corporate worship, and opening our homes to one another.

(Acts 2:42-46)

 

We are committed to purpose

The primary purpose of our fellowship is to make disciples. We will accomplish this through boldly sharing the good news of Jesus Christ in word, and deed.

(Matthew 28: 19-20)

 

We are committed to innovation and creativity

While the message is timeless our methods adapt to those we are here to serve.

(Mark 2:22, Genesis 1:1-2:25)

 

We are committed to love, unity, and forgiveness 

Our fellowship is an extended family where all individuals will discover a warm, safe, place to belong.

(1 Corinthians 13:1-13, John 17:1, Mark 11:25)
